Well, I have ~5k block unbuffed
He's using the gems or runes with block, might and partial block+parry mitigation on both LIs, that's another 1.2k block
He has 250 more might than me, thats another 1k block
He's most likely using Shield Mastery since he has the mitigation buff from it, that's another 2.5k block
He probably has Balance of Man trait (my Wrd is an Elf -_-) for another 260 block.
That combined should give 10k, so it's quite possible to get.

At 5,275 my incoming healing is 20%. The cap for man is 30% and other races is 25%. I would think of my inc healing as average than low and yes those t9 relics are good and sadly i decon them by accident. That being said they are no longer in the game and there are not allot of options for increasing inc healing. I can increase it by 6%(rounding it up) via relics and an extra 1% via gear. A total of 7% and the trade off is less parry and evade are the noticeable ones. Currently my setup is working great for me and it got me thinking how good is inc healing now with the state of the warden?
Incoming healing increases the morale which is healed. We can say its not really needed for 3/6mans t2 since we can solo some of its bosses and if aggro is not an issue due to our self heals. When it comes to 12mans we can solo draigoch, skirmishes are easy which leaves us to Orthanc t2. While its a must have for orthanc there are some attacks that will 1shot or soon kill you if you are not fully healed or you are slow to react but we can counter these attacks with NS and DC even if its only once. Its just my view but inc healing is not as important as it was since 6.1.
